    I think the truth of all this lies somewhere in the middle.

    The food smelled nice and what people were eating did look good. Limerick is also crying out for events like this. However, it's difficult how people could say the execution of the great idea was anything other than pretty poor.

    They should have opened the Milk Market at both ends with ticket sellers at each end. That would have helped flow.

    They also should have spread the stands out much more, there were very tightly packed, creating confusion as to which queue was for what.

    I'm not sure who organised it, I guess it was volunteers, so they tried their best. I'm surprised that the stall vendors didn't have more control over the organisation of it, a lot of the established businesses could surely have offered pointers in layout etc.

    I do wish them all the best for the future, some more thought next time could create a fantastic event. Next time though I will have a wander in before i commit to tickets just in case, was lucky I got a refund the last night.
